There’s a Group for just about everyone. Some Groups gather around Bible studies and faith discussions, while others connect through activities, hobbies, sports, serving opportunities, life stages, or shared interests. You might find Groups centered around coffee, fitness, golf, young families, men’s or women’s gatherings, young adults, and much more. Groups are led by people who are passionate about creating community around something they enjoy.

A new semester of Groups launches several times throughout the year. When registration opens, you can browse available Groups online and find one that fits your interests, schedule, and stage of life. Simply join a Group or reach out to the leader through the directory with any questions. The goal is to make finding community simple and accessible for everyone.
